Wolff doesn't believe Hamilton will quit F1
Toto Wolff doesn't believe Lewis Hamilton will quit Formula 1 at the end of this season despite the Brit's post-race comments at Imola. Taking his record-breaking 93rd grand prix win at Sunday's Emilia Romagna Grand Prix, Hamilton was asked about his future and that of Wolff's. Both Mercedes men, instrumental in the team's run of seven successive Constructors' crowns, are out of contract at the end of this season. Hamilton replied: 'I don't even know if I'm going to be here next year so it's not really a concern for me at the moment.
